Vehicle Market Growth Trajectory and Segment Dynamics

Market Overview and Introduction

Vehicle Market Growth reflects the sustained global demand for mobility and transportation, with the sector valued at 1550.3 billion USD in 2024 and projected to reach 2500 billion USD by 2035. This impressive growth trajectory encompasses diverse vehicle types including passenger cars, commercial vehicles, two-wheelers, and heavy-duty trucks, each responding to distinct economic, demographic, and technological trends. The industry's robust 4.4% CAGR indicates strong momentum driven by urbanization, rising disposable incomes, e-commerce expansion, and the accelerating transition toward electric and autonomous vehicles across all vehicle categories.

Key Growth Drivers

Rising global urbanization, with UN data projecting nearly 68% of the world population in urban areas by 2050, is a primary growth engine, driving demand for personal and commercial vehicles. Technological advancements, particularly in EVs and autonomous driving, are propelling the market, with IEA data showing electric vehicle sales surged by 41% in 2021. Government initiatives and regulations on emissions, such as the EU's target to reduce greenhouse gas emissions by at least 55% by 2030, push manufacturers toward cleaner vehicles. Increasing e-commerce activities boost demand for commercial vehicles and last-mile delivery solutions.

Regional Insights and Preferences

North America leads with a 525 billion USD valuation in 2024, projected to reach 870 billion USD by 2035, driven by EV adoption and supportive policies. Europe follows closely, with rapid EV adoption propelled by the European Green Deal. The Asia-Pacific region exhibits the highest growth rate, driven by a surge in EV adoption in China and supportive government initiatives.

Technological Innovations and Emerging Trends

Passenger Cars dominate the market, valued at 750 billion USD in 2024, projected to rise to 1150 billion USD by 2035, catering to personal transportation needs. Commercial Vehicles exhibit steady expansion, vital for goods movement and logistics. Two Wheelers are experiencing strong growth, especially in regions with urban congestion.
